Intake 2: The Future
Description
Intake is a Python package for describing, finding and sharing dataset specs, so that you can load them with a minimum of fuss. It has been around for a number of years, and has found a number of uses within the Pangeo community through plugins such as intake-stac, intake-esm and others. In this talk I will go over the challenges of adoption for intake, and why the appearance of the catalog concept in anaconda.cloud has spurred a rethink and large scale rewrite of Intake, with a V2 hopefully coming this year. There is much that is new and much that is discarded! Hoping for honest feedback on the design so far!
